
Very hot air currents are entering Uzbekistan - according to Uzhydromet, this week the temperature will be much higher than usual in all regions of the country. Experts and forecasters have clearly stated that under the influence of hot air currents coming from the south, on June 16-17 in Karakalpakstan and Khorezm, and on June 17-19 throughout the republic, the air temperature will rise to 40-42 degrees during the day, and in some desert and southern regions to 43-44 degrees.
There is no escaping the heat, it's hot at night
The effects of the heat will also be noticeable at night: the air will be around 24-27 degrees, with a slight coolness only in the morning hours. This can cause inconvenience to the population and reduce the quality of sleep. The temperature will drop slightly by the end of the week - daytime temperatures will be 35-38 degrees, and in the south - around 39-41 degrees.
Partly cloudy, windy and dusty days are expected
In Tashkent, mostly partly cloudy weather will remain, no precipitation is expected. In the capital today, it will warm up to 36-38 degrees, and on June 17-19 - up to 38-41 degrees, and on June 20 it will be slightly cooler - around 35-37 degrees.
On June 16-18, in the north and in the desert regions, and on June 19-21, in many regions, there is a high probability of strong winds (13-18 m/s) and dust in some places. At the same time, on June 20, short-term rain and thunderstorms are possible in mountainous regions.
Life-saving recommendations from doctors and the sanitary committee
Joining the rapid hydrometeorological information of “Uzhydromet”, the Committee for Sanitary and Epidemiological Wellbeing and Public Health reminded of important recommendations for protecting yourself on hot days:
- Protect yourself from direct sunlight, spend more time in the shade and indoors;
- Choose light, light and loose clothing, use a hat and sunglasses;
- Drink more water, those with chronic diseases should be especially careful;
- Limit active physical activity, especially at lunchtime;
- In severe heat, young children, the elderly and pregnant women need special protection.
